Types of Construction Jobs You Can Apply for in the USA

Construction opportunities in the USA cover a wide range of roles that foreign applicants can apply for depending on their physical ability and experience level.

General Labor Construction Jobs involve basic tasks such as carrying materials, site cleaning, and assisting skilled workers. These roles typically earn between $45,000 and $47,000 per year.

Carpentry Assistant Jobs involve supporting carpenters in building frameworks, installing wood structures, and preparing materials. These positions may pay around $46,000 to $49,000 per year depending on experience.

Masonry Assistant Jobs focus on assisting bricklayers and stone workers in construction projects. Salaries often range from $45,000 to $50,000 per year with overtime opportunities.

Construction Equipment Helper Roles involve supporting operators of heavy machinery. These jobs can earn between $47,000 and $50,000 per year.

Painting and Finishing Jobs involve preparing surfaces, painting buildings, and finishing construction projects. These roles typically pay between $45,000 and $48,000 per year.

These categories show that construction jobs are not limited to one skill type and provide multiple opportunities for immigrants applying under sponsorship programs.

Challenges of Construction Jobs in the USA

Despite the benefits, construction jobs also come with challenges. The work is physically demanding and often requires long hours under different weather conditions.

Workers may also need to adapt to strict safety regulations and workplace standards. Communication challenges may arise for those with limited English proficiency.

However, with time and experience, many foreign workers adjust successfully and continue to build stable careers in the construction industry.
